Solve x - (x*0.8 - 5000)*0.03 = 7226 for x.

Question

Solve for xx:

x(0.8x5000)0.03=7226x-\left(0.8x-5000\right)\cdot 0.03=7226

Step-by-step solution

  1. Expand the bracket before touching the subtraction. Multiplying each term inside by 0.030.03:

    0.03(0.8x5000)=0.024x1500.03\left(0.8x-5000\right)=0.024x-150

    Doing this first means you only have to worry about one sign change, in the next step.

  2. Distribute the leading minus sign across both terms. This is where most sign errors happen: the minus applies to 150-150 as well, turning it into +150+150:

    x(0.024x150)=x0.024x+150x-\left(0.024x-150\right)=x-0.024x+150

    so the equation becomes

    0.976x+150=72260.976x+150=7226

  3. Isolate the xx-term. Subtract 150150 from both sides:

    0.976x=70760.976x=7076

  4. Divide by the coefficient.

    x=70760.976=7076000976=7250x=\frac{7076}{0.976}=\frac{7076000}{976}=7250

    The division is exact here — 0.976×7250=70760.976\times 7250=7076 with no rounding — which is a strong hint that 72267226 was chosen deliberately.

  5. Check in the original equation. With x=7250x=7250: 0.8(7250)=58000.8(7250)=5800, so 58005000=8005800-5000=800, and 0.03×800=240.03\times 800=24. Then 725024=7226 7250-24=7226\ \checkmark. Notice the check runs through the original bracket, not the expanded form, so it would also catch a distribution mistake.

Answer

x=7250x=7250
